Picture-Based Study Methods
Although many participants grasp difficult chemistry material through established practices, visual learning techniques can notably enhance knowledge for those who thrive on mental pictures and spatial orientation. Tutors can embed diagrams, atomic models, and charts to present chemical reactions and structures, making abstract ideas more perceivable. Utilizing color-coded notes and interactive simulations can engage visual learners, helping them to envision intermolecular forces or transformation steps. Furthermore, presenting videos that display experiments or applied copyrightples of chemistry can furnish understanding and enhance recall ability. By modifying their teaching approaches to weave in these picture-based elements, teachers can create a more welcoming learning environment, catering to assorted learning tendencies and ultimately fostering a fuller comprehension of chemistry concepts among their pupils.

How Much Do Chemistry Tutoring Classes Typically Cost?
Chemistry tutoring sessions generally cost between $30 to $100 per hour, depending on factors such as the tutor's expertise, area, and duration of sessions. Rates can differ widely based on individual circumstances and specific needs.
